## Changelog — MatchCore 4.2

The setting `GC_PAUSE_BUDGET` has been renamed to `MATCH_GC_PAUSE_TARGET_MS` to clarify that it caps garbage-collection pauses in the matching loop, measured in milliseconds. Update your env files accordingly; the old name is ignored as of this release. The renamed entry should sit directly above the service's telemetry signing key, which appears on the line below.

vault entry, kajog-kawig: VAULT_KEY13=6b0c5c5ead68a

Handover note — reception, Fenwright Building

Hi Tomas, a few things on the cleaning crew before your shift. The Ashgrove crew arrives nightly around 19:15 through the courtyard door, usually four people. Check them against the roster sheet in the top drawer and log their arrival time. They no longer carry individual badges since last month's change, so you'll need to let them in using the courtyard door code below.

turnstile pass: bdg-QZV-3

Hey Tomas — handing over the session-token refresh bug in Fernlock before I'm out. Short version: the refresh worker races the expiry sweep, so tokens occasionally get revoked mid-refresh and users see phantom logouts. My branch serializes the two via an advisory lock; tests pass but please eyeball the timeout handling, I'm not thrilled with it. To reproduce locally you need the sweep interval cranked way down — run the service with the following settings.

service settings:
[druvan]
port = 8000
team = gorir
host = druvan.paliqworks.corp
region = central-1
access_code = ac_0d333e
timeout_ms = 1000

Scope: emergency access to the Shelfwright import pipeline when a bad MARC batch blocks all merges and the pipeline owner is unavailable.

Reviewer responsibilities: confirm the blocking import run, verify the rollback diff touches only staging tables, and record the run identifier in the incident log. Do not approve schema changes under break-glass. Access expires after two hours; re-entry requires a fresh justification.

The emergency console unlocks only after you supply the recovery passphrase recorded below.

strongbox words: sorir-belvan-rusix-ulays-ralmir-praix-eliir-tamax-praael-druael-julir-tamius-jorir